以太坊钱包收款提醒接口:你需要知道的那些事

                引言:为什么要关注以太坊钱包的收款提醒接口?

                嘿,朋友们!今天咱们来聊聊以太坊钱包的收款提醒接口,是的,你没听错。可能有小伙伴会问:“这东西有什么用?直接查看钱包不就行了吗?”我告诉你,收款提醒的接口就像是你的私人助理,专门负责提醒你每一笔收款。想象一下,你在忙着炒菜、追剧,突然收到一笔ETH,能及时知道,简直带劲!

                什么是以太坊钱包的收款提醒接口?

                先说说什么是“收款提醒接口”。它其实是一个API(应用程序接口),你可以通过它获得关于你的以太坊钱包里收款的变化信息。简单来说,就是当有人给你发ETH时,这个接口会通知你。它的工作原理有点复杂,但你只需知道,它能帮你及时掌握资金动态,哪怕你正在参加亲戚的婚礼,也不会错过意外的惊喜。

                以太坊钱包的类型选择

                在考虑收款提醒接口前,首先得有个以太坊钱包。现在市场上有好几种类型的钱包,你得先选一个适合自己的。

                • 硬件钱包:像Ledger和Trezor。安全性超高,适合长期存储。缺点是比较麻烦,有时还得花心思充电。
                • 软件钱包:这包括桌面钱包和手机钱包,例如MetaMask和Trust Wallet。简单易用,随时随地都能查看。
                • 平台钱包:像Coinbase和Binance的这类钱包,方便快捷,适合新手。不过要注意,安全性相对较低,最好不要把大额资产放在这里。

                选好钱包后,你可以通过钱包提供的SDK或API来接入收款提醒功能。这个过程可能需要一些技术背景,或是叫上帮手来弄。

                如何实现收款提醒?

                好啦,终于到了关键时刻,如何实现收款提醒呢?这里有几种常见的方法:

                • 使用Websocket:这是实时通讯的一种方式,你可以连接以太坊节点,当你的钱包地址有交易时,节点会发出通知,立马就能知道自己收到了多少ETH。
                • 轮询API:这种方法比较简单,但延迟可能会高。你可以定时查询你的钱包,不断检查新的交易记录。如果发现新交易,就发个提醒。虽然效率没那么高,但也能完成任务。
                • 结合第三方服务:有一些提供现成的服务,比如Infura和Alchemy,可以帮助你快速接入,省去不少麻烦。其中Infura还提供了不少开箱即用的API,你只要照着文档走就行。

                如何使用收款提醒接口?

                具体使用的时候,你可以通过编程语言来实现,比如Python、JavaScript等。以下是一个简单的示例,假设你用Python来实现收款提醒,基本思路是这样的:

                  
                import requests  
                import time  
                
                def check_balance(address):  
                    # 这里是调用你的API,获取余额  
                    response = requests.get(f"https://api.infura.io/v1/jsonrpc/mainnet/eth_getBalance?params=['{address}', 'latest']")  
                    balance = response.json()  
                    return balance  
                
                def main():  
                    address = "你的以太坊地址"  
                    last_balance = check_balance(address)  
                    while True:  
                        time.sleep(10)  # 每10秒检查一次  
                        current_balance = check_balance(address)  
                        if current_balance != last_balance:  
                            print("收到新收款!")  
                            last_balance = current_balance  
                
                if __name__ == "__main__":  
                    main()  
                

                上面的代码很简单,对了,你得把“你的以太坊地址”替换成你真正的以太坊地址哦。知道怎么查余额,接下来就可以部署上去,随时待命,等着收款提醒了。

                实际使用注意事项

                收款提醒接口虽然方便,但实际使用中也要注意一些

                • 网络安全:必须保证你的代码和API调用是安全的。不要把私钥或钱包信息暴露出来,坏人可不待见这样的机会。
                • 延迟使用第三方服务时,你可能会遇到延迟,要做好这个心理准备。别太依赖实时性。
                • 费用尽量了解清楚是否有调用API的费用,有些服务会根据使用量收费,这也得算入你的成本。

                互动出来的建议,交流、分享和社区

                如果你实在不懂,随时可以去各大开发者社区问问,像Reddit、Stack Overflow这些地方,绝对不缺聪明人。别害羞,主动问问题,学习新东西的过程总是要尝试,同时也能认识志同道合的小伙伴。

                总结

                以太坊钱包的收款提醒接口真的是个相当有用的工具,无论你是投资者,还是开发者,甚至只是个买菜的普通用户。及时掌握你钱包的动态,简直是未来生活的小助手。希望今天相当干货的分享,能帮助到你。如果你还有其他问题,随时可以问我哦!

                希望你能顺利接入收款提醒功能,等着迎接每一笔到来的ETH吧!

                    author

                    Appnox App

                    content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                
                                        
                                    

                                related post

                                            leave a reply